Here´s my concept.

My telephone would be a revision of the old model we all grew up with (Or at least I did). It should have a common handle, with sleek lines, somewhat crome (or black matte) finish.

The futuristic line is solved by using a dial much like MP3s players, where the person would actually rotate the dial (Number lights going of meanwhile), and when the user has his desired number, he would press down on the dial. (Idea is still under revision -modelling should start and finish tomorrow-)

Handle is wireless. What? That´s the future dude!

Here it is, The "AdlPhono"
